13. Un esempio classico è il “rickrolling” : nel 2007 su 4chan si assiste a un revival di Rick Astley una vecchia popstar anni ’80 ormai in declino. Il video “ Never Gonna Give You Up” diventa un vero e proprio meme, che gradualmente inizia a diffondersi in ogni canale possibile, totalizzando la bellezza di 30 milioni di visite… Nel 2008 la Sony per sfruttare il successo pubblica un Greatest Hit "The Ultimate Collection: Rick Astley“ che scala le classifiche internazionali…. … sempre nel 2008 Rick Astley vince il premio “Best Act Ever” degli MTV Europe Music Awards, grazie all’intervento massivo delle Comunità Online creatrici del meme e di fan vecchi e nuovi!
